Hey folks, I just posted this video about shooting soft light images and there's a couple of pictures that incorporate a few of my finds in the image. I thought you guys might gather a few ideas on incorporating some of your finds into warm pieces of wall art. Anyone can do it. All it takes is a little setup, a few props, and a camera that can take long exposures.
